diff --git a/libs/freetdm/src/ftmod/ftmod_sangoma_isdn/ftmod_sangoma_isdn_stack_rcv.c b/libs/freetdm/src/ftmod/ftmod_sangoma_isdn/ftmod_sangoma_isdn_stack_rcv.c index f5ff189ad7..e63649bf5f 100644 --- a/libs/freetdm/src/ftmod/ftmod_sangoma_isdn/ftmod_sangoma_isdn_stack_rcv.c +++ b/libs/freetdm/src/ftmod/ftmod_sangoma_isdn/ftmod_sangoma_isdn_stack_rcv.c @@ -1000,7 +1000,9 @@ void sngisdn_rcv_sng_log(uint8_t level, char *fmt,...) ftdm_log(FTDM_LOG_DEBUG, "sng_isdn->%s", data); break; case SNG_LOGLEVEL_WARN: - ftdm_log(FTDM_LOG_INFO, "sng_isdn->%s", data); + if ( strncmp(data, 'Invalid Q.921/Q.931 frame', 25) ) { + ftdm_log(FTDM_LOG_INFO, "sng_isdn->%s", data); + } break; case SNG_LOGLEVEL_INFO: ftdm_log(FTDM_LOG_INFO, "sng_isdn->%s", data);